本篇和大家分享的是springboot打包并结合shell脚本命令部署,重点在分享一个shell程序启动工具,希望能便利工作;

  • profiles指定不同环境的配置
  • maven-assembly-plugin打发布压缩包
  • 分享shenniu_publish.sh程序启动工具
  • linux上使用shenniu_publish.sh启动程序

profiles指定不同环境的配置

通常一套程序分为了很多个部署环境:开发,测试,uat,线上 等,我们要想对这些环境区分配置文件,可以通过两种方式:

  • 通过application.yml中编码指定 profile.active=uat 方式指定
  • 通过mvn中profiles来区分不同环境对应的配置文件夹,人工可以手动在idea勾选生成不同环境的包(推荐)

这里我们要讲的是第二种,首先在mvn中配置如下内容:

maven-assembly-plugin打发布压缩包

对于springboot程序打包,可以分为jar和war,这里是jar包;有场景是咋们配置文件或者第三方等依赖包不想放到工程jar中,并且把这些文件压缩成一个zip包,方便上传到linux;此时通过maven-assembly-plugin和maven-jar-plugin就可以做到,mvn的配置如:

<code><plugin>
                <groupid>org.apache.maven.plugins/<groupid>
                <artifactid>maven-jar-plugin/<artifactid>
                <version>2.6/<version>
                <configuration>
                    <archive>
                        <addmavendescriptor>false/<addmavendescriptor>
                        <manifest>
                            <addclasspath>true/<addclasspath>
                            <classpathprefix>lib//<classpathprefix>
                            <mainclass>${scripts_bootMain}/<mainclass>
                        /<manifest>
                    /<archive>
                    
                    <excludes>
                        <exclude>**/*.yml/<exclude>
                        <exclude>**/*.properties/<exclude>
                        <exclude>**/*.xml/<exclude>
                        <exclude>**/*.sh/<exclude>
                    /<excludes>
                /<configuration>
                <executions>
                    <execution>
                        make-a-jar
                        <phase>compile/<phase>
                        <goals>
                            <goal>jar/<goal>

                        /<goals>
                    /<execution>
                /<executions>
            /<plugin>

            <plugin>
                <groupid>org.apache.maven.plugins/<groupid>
                <artifactid>maven-assembly-plugin/<artifactid>
                <version>2.4/<version>
                
                <configuration>
                    
                    <descriptors>
                        <descriptor>${project.basedir}/src/main/assembly/assembly.xml/<descriptor>
                    /<descriptors>
                /<configuration>
                <executions>
                    <execution>
                        make-assembly
                        <phase>package/<phase>
                        <goals>
                            <goal>single/<goal>
                        /<goals>
                    /<execution>
                /<executions>
            /<plugin>/<code>

值得注意的地方如下几点:

  • mainClass节点:用来指定启动main函数入口类路径,如这里的:com.sm.EurekaServerApplication
  • excludes节点:排除主jar包中配置等一些列后缀文件,因为我们要包这些配置文件放到主包外面
  • descriptor节点:用来指定assembly插件对应的assembly.xml配置文件

有了上面mvn配置,我们还需要assembly.xml的配置,这里提取了结合shell脚本发布程序的配置:

<code><assembly>          xsi:schemaLocation="http://maven.apache.org/ASSEMBLY/2.0.0 http://maven.apache.org/xsd/assembly-2.0.0.xsd
http://maven.apache.org/ASSEMBLY/2.0.0 ">
    ${activeProfile}
    
    <formats>
        <format>zip/<format>
    /<formats>
    
    <includebasedirectory>false/<includebasedirectory>
    <dependencysets>
        <dependencyset>
            
            <useprojectartifact>false/<useprojectartifact>
            <outputdirectory>${package-name}-${activeProfile}/lib/<outputdirectory>
            <unpack>false/<unpack>
        /<dependencyset>
    /<dependencysets>

    <filesets>
        
        <fileset>
            <directory>${project.basedir}/src/main/profiles/${activeProfile}/<directory>
            <outputdirectory>${package-name}-${activeProfile}/conf/<outputdirectory>
            <includes>
                <include>**/*/<include>
                
                

                
            /<includes>
        /<fileset>

        
        <fileset>
            <directory>${project.basedir}/src/main/scripts/<directory>
            <outputdirectory>
            <includes>
                <include>**/*/<include>
            /<includes>
            
            <filemode>777/<filemode>
            
            <directorymode>777/<directorymode>
            
            <filtered>true/<filtered>
        /<fileset>

        
        <fileset>
            <directory>${project.build.directory}/<directory>
            <outputdirectory>${package-name}-${activeProfile}//<outputdirectory>
            <includes>
                <include>*.jar/<include>
            /<includes>
        /<fileset>
    /<filesets>
/<assembly>/<code>

重点节点介绍:

  • formats节点:把配置文件和jar包等压缩成什么文件格式,这里可以有:zip,tar等
  • fileMode节点:指定scripts目录下脚本文件(这里是:shenniu_publish.sh)在linux上文件权限为777
  • filtered节点:脚本中参数变量为pom的profiles中properties的值(该配置,是把mvn中属性值映射生成到sh文件中,如:${package-name})

分享shenniu_publish.sh程序启动工具

上面步骤完成了zip格式的发布包,我们再分享下启动程序的shell脚本,该脚本具有的功能如:

  • 解压zip+启动jar包
  • 启动jar包
  • 停止对应jar运行
  • 重启jar程序

目前该shell中封装了两种启动jar命令的方式:

  • java -cp
  • java -jar

如图命令格式:

来看全部的shell代码:

<code>#!/usr/bin/env bash
#可变参数变量
languageType="javac" #支持 java,javac,netcore 发布
#参数值由pom文件传递
baseZipName="${package-name}-${activeProfile}" #压缩包名称  publish-test.zip的publish
packageName="${package-name}" #命令启动包名 xx.jar的xx
mainclass="${boot-main}" #java -cp启动时,指定main入口类;命令:java -cp conf;lib\\*.jar;${packageName}.jar ${mainclass}

#例子
# baseZipName="publish-test" #压缩包名称  publish-test.zip的publish
# packageName="publish" #命令启动包名 publish.jar的xx

#固定变量
basePath=$(cd `dirname $0`/; pwd)
baseZipPath="${basePath}/${baseZipName}.zip"  #压缩包路径
baseDirPath="${basePath}" #解压部署磁盘路径
pid= #进程pid

#解压
function shenniu_unzip()
{
    echo "解压---------------------------------------------"
    echo "压缩包路径:${baseZipPath}"
    if [ ! `find ${baseZipPath}` ]
    then
        echo "不存在压缩包:${baseZipPath}"
    else
        echo "解压磁盘路径:${baseDirPath}/${baseZipName}"
        echo "开始解压..."

        #解压命令
        unzip -od ${baseDirPath}/${baseZipName} ${baseZipPath}

        #设置执行权限

        chmod +x ${baseDirPath}/${baseZipName}/${packageName}

        echo "解压完成。"  
    fi
}

#检测pid
function getPid()
{
    echo "检测状态---------------------------------------------"
    pid=`ps -ef | grep -n ${packageName} | grep -v grep | awk '{print $2}'`
    if [ ${pid} ] 
    then
        echo "运行pid:${pid}"
    else
        echo "未运行"
    fi
}

#启动程序
function start()
{
    #启动前,先停止之前的
    stop
    if [ ${pid} ]
    then
        echo "停止程序失败,无法启动"
    else
        echo "启动程序---------------------------------------------"

        #选择语言类型
        read -p "输入程序类型(java,javac,netcore),下一步按回车键(默认:${languageType}):" read_languageType
        if [ ${read_languageType} ]
        then
            languageType=${read_languageType}
        fi
        echo "选择程序类型:${languageType}"

        #进入运行包目录
        cd ${baseDirPath}/${baseZipName}

        #分类启动

        if [ "${languageType}" == "javac" ] 
        then
            if [ ${mainclass} ] 
            then
                nohup java -cp conf:lib\\*.jar:${packageName}.jar ${mainclass} >${baseDirPath}/${packageName}.out 2>&1 &
               #nohup java -cp conf:lib\\*.jar:${packageName}.jar ${mainclass} >/dev/null 2>&1 &
            fi
        elif [ "${languageType}" == "java" ] 
        then
            nohup java -jar ${baseDirPath}/${baseZipName}/${packageName}.jar >/dev/null 2>&1 &
            # java -jar ${baseDirPath}/${baseZipName}/${packageName}.jar
        elif [ "${languageType}" == "netcore" ] 
        then
            #nohup dotnet run ${baseDirPath}/${baseZipName}/${packageName} >/dev/null 2>&1 &
            nohup ${baseDirPath}/${baseZipName}/${packageName} >/dev/null 2>&1 &
        fi

        #查询是否有启动进程
        getPid
        if [ ${pid} ]
        then
            echo "已启动"
            #nohup日志
            tail -n 50 -f ${baseDirPath}/${packageName}.out
        else
            echo "启动失败"
        fi
    fi
}

#停止程序
function stop()
{
    getPid
    if [ ${pid} ] 
    then
        echo "停止程序---------------------------------------------"
        kill -9 ${pid}

        getPid
        if [ ${pid} ] 
        then
            #stop
            echo "停止失败"
        else
            echo "停止成功"
        fi

    fi
}

#启动时带参数,根据参数执行
if [ ${#} -ge 1 ] 
then
    case ${1} in
        "start") 
            start
        ;;
        "restart") 
            start
        ;;
        "stop") 
            stop
        ;;
        "unzip") 
            #执行解压
            shenniu_unzip
            #执行启动
            start
        ;;
        *) 
            echo "${1}无任何操作"
        ;;
    esac
else
    echo "
    command如下命令:
    unzip:解压并启动
    start:启动
    stop:停止进程
    restart:重启

    示例命令如:./shenniu_publish start
    "
fi/<code>

正如上面小节说的,shell中的参数 package-name,activeProfile,boot-main 都是由mvn中profiles的properties中提供,是可变的参数,脚本代码本身不需要人工去修改,只需要变的是mvn的参数即可;其实在我们生成zip包的时候,shell中的参数就被替换了,可以看zip中shell文件内容如:

linux上使用shenniu_publish.sh启动程序

把生成的zip上传到linux上,通过命令解压:

<code>unzip -od eureka-server-0.0.1-node eureka-server-0.0.1-node.zip/<code>

其实shell脚本中包含有解压命令,但是我在打包时放在了zip中,所以只能通过手动解压了,当然可以调整;此时进入加压目录如此:

注:这里第一次执行./shenniu_publish.sh脚本时候,提示了错误信息;是由于我是在windows上编辑的这个脚本,其空格等和linux上不一样,所以运行会有问题,要解决可以使用vim命令在linux把该文件转成linux格式,如下命令:

<code>vim shenniu_publish.sh
set ff=unix
:wq/<code>

执行完后,再来运行脚本./shenniu_publish.sh,此时有如下提示:
